To obtain a CPL (Commercial Pilot License) in India, you must have a prior Student Pilot License (SPL) and Private Pilot License (PPL).

With an incredible course duration of 12 months, the fee for pilot training from a flying school in India is between 35-50 lakhs, which is not that cost-effective. Students are given comprehensive ground classes for all DGCA subjects to pass the DGCA exam, try their hands on state-of-the-art simulators before flying real machines and have 200 flying hours with a multi-engine endorsement at the end. Commercial pilot license fee may vary from institute to institute depending on the course, there are many flight schools or clubs in India and abroad which offer commercial pilot licences. Commercial pilot license fees include various expenses like accommodation, food, tuition fee, library fee, miscellaneous expenses etc.
Getting trained in India is not the most cost-effective option. The cost of pilot training in India depends on the flying school you choose. However, doing your training in India helps you avoid the long queue for license transfer.
A commercial pilot license (CPL) is not a diploma or degree, it is a licensed program for pilots. Interested candidate can take flying training from any institute approved by Directorate General of Civil Aviation (DGCA) to pursue this course. Students need to complete 200 flying hours from flying school in commercial pilot license course to become a pilot but first, the eligibility criteria required for commercial pilot license (CPL), a candidate must pass or pass 10+2 with Physics, Chemistry. , and must pass Mathematics (PCM) or equivalent for admission to flying schools.
